   / Americans do not appreciate good food... #47  
Glad we agree...most yankees don't have a clue how to cook grits...There's not much to it the only difference is the consistency they are cooked to...you can always ask for a texture you prefer...

I like them so they blend well with poached eggs on toast with or without a dollop of hollandaise...

I make several versions, but use Dixie Lilly yellow grits for all. Breakfast grits should never be runny; shrimp and grits should be made with whole milk, not water; and NEVER use instant grits... gotta cook them 15 to 20 minutes.
